Preact is an open-source JavaScript library for building user interfaces. Preact has a similar structure and features to React, but it's smaller in size because of its efficient code base. Developers use Preact as a foundation for their web applications without the overhead found in larger frameworks. The framework provides components, virtual DOM support to optimize UI updates, and state management options that help build complex apps structured around data changes. Due to its similarity with React, it allows developers familiar with React to transition smoothly while delivering faster load times and better performance on low-powered devices.

